The ideal candidate will possess a strong mechanical knowledge and experience in working with hand tools and power tools. As a Fitter, you will be responsible for assembling vechicle components to meet precise specifications. This role requires attention to detail and the ability to work effectively in a fast-paced environment.
Responsibilities
Use hand tools and power tools to cut, shape, and join materials.
Install Panels on vechicles
Seak joints with Gel coatings
Conduct inspections of finished products to ensure quality standards are met.
Maintain a clean and safe working environment by following safety protocols.
Collaborate with team members to improve processes and resolve any fabrication issues.
Requirements
Proven experience as a Fitter or in a similar role within the manufacturing or engineering sector.
Strong mechanical knowledge with the ability to understand drawings.
Proficiency in using hand tools and power tools.
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ality workmanship.
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to work well under pressure.
Hours of Work
0700 - 1630 Monday to Thursday & 0700 - 1530 on a Friday
Up to 44hrs a week
Rates of pay and Benefits
£15.60phr + 20 days annual leave plus Bank Holidays.
Extra day off for your Birthday
Enhanced Maternity and Paternity pay policies.
Access to wellness programme and Employee Assistance Programmes, including WeCare from Canada Life (EAP with 24HR Online GP access and second Medical Opinion).
Branded uniform.
Death in service benefit
